What is ABA Therapy and How It Helps Autism?

ABA therapy is a scientifically proven behavioral treatment approach that focuses on understanding behavior and teaching positive skills through structured learning techniques. It is widely used for children with autism to improve communication, social interaction, attention, and daily living skills.

Children are taught through repetition, reinforcement, structured activities, and step-by-step learning methods that make skill development easier and more effective.

Common Behavioral Challenges in Children with Autism

Children with autism may display different behavioral patterns that require structured intervention. Early identification and therapy can significantly improve developmental outcomes.

Common challenges include:

  • Delayed speech or no verbal communication
  • Poor eye contact
  • Repetitive behaviors
  • Difficulty responding to name
  • Limited social interaction
  • Sensory sensitivities
  • Aggressive or self-stimulatory behaviors
  • Difficulty following instructions
  • Emotional outbursts or frustration

Therapists break down complex skills into smaller steps so children can learn gradually and successfully. Progress is continuously monitored and updated to ensure steady improvement.

Parent Involvement in Autism Therapy

Parental involvement is a key part of successful autism therapy. Children learn faster when therapy techniques are reinforced at home in daily routines.
